Hi everyone
I have a marina 1275 a plus engine, all complete with flywheel, back plates manifold. It is in stripped down Staite all labels up ready for reconditioning, what would the value of this engine be if I was to sell it?
Also what do people value 1275 Mg midget gearbox at?

It all depends on condition.
People usually want a running engine rather than a stripped one.

As for prices well I paid £90 for a complete seized 1275 engine with a 12G940 cylinder head a few months ago.
But I have seen stripped engines being advertised for around the £200 mark with complete running engines fetching upwards of £800

As for the Gearbox well again if it is an MG Midget box as identified by the stamping on the main shaft (22G229) with some history then somewhere around the £100 £200 mark but again an unknown gearbox will require a rebuild so the price may be lower.
